FIELD: measuring.
SUBSTANCE: group of inventions relates to the field of environmental protection, in particular to means of monitoring the functional state of aquatic animals for environmental monitoring of the aquatic environment. Method for controlling the physiological state of bivalve molluscs involves placing the test animals with physiological state measuring devices in an aqueous medium, formation by measuring devices of electrical signals of physiological state of tested animals, amplification of obtained electric signals, analogue-to-digital conversion of their values, their input into a computer and storage for further processing. Each bivalve mollusc is placed on a removable element made with possibility of its rotation relative to the platform posts, to which the bivalve mollusc is attached. As a parameter of the electrical signal carrying information on the physiological state of the test animal, the amplitude or period or frequency of the electrical signal of the cardiac rhythm and change in the distances between the valves obtained from the cardiac rhythm sensors and the valve opening sensors are used. System for monitoring the physiological state of bivalve molluscs comprises a computer, measuring instruments of the physiological state of tested animals, amplifiers, connected by input to measuring instruments of physiological state of tested animals, and analogue-to-digital converter, connected by inputs to outputs of amplifiers, and by output – to computer. Besides, it is equipped with a platform with stands and detachable elements for placement of tested molluscs.
EFFECT: increased reliability of control of physiological state of bivalve molluscs.
